Spain’s referee committee believe official got two VAR decisions wrong in Real Madrid 3-2 Almería

The refereeing collective believe that Hernández Hernández judged two VAR reviews incorrectly in the game that saw Real Madrid stage a dramatic comeback.

The refereeing performance during the Real Madrid-Almería match continues to add pages to the story. As revealed by journalist Manu Carrreño on Spanish radio show, El Larguero, the Refereeing Committee in Spain (CTA) have acknowledged that Hernández Hernández, who was in charge of the VAR, was wrong with two of the three reviews that were key to the outcome of the match. The referees’ association consider that the referee was not right neither in awarding a penalty for Kaiky’s handball nor giving Vinicius’ goal.

In the first instance, which opened the scoring and set Real Madrid on the road to the comeback, the CTA believe that Hernández Hernández was wrong not to take into account everything that happened in the move. More specifically, they consider that he focused solely on Kaiky’s handball, but not on the possible fouls by Rüdiger and Joselu, as explained by the journalist.

CTA reveal their concern with VAR approach

The other error they see in the referee’s performance came with Vinicius’ goal, with which Ancelotti’s team drew level in the match. The CTA believes that Hernández Hernández should not have called the on-field referee, Hernández Maeso, to see the play at the screen, since in the images he was shown, it is not clear whether the ball hits the Brazilian’s arm or shoulder.

The game was a crazy affair, VAR (almost) aside, as bottom of the league Almería went 0-2 ahead at the home of the 35-time league winners. It took goals from Bellingham and Vini Jr with a late Dani Carvajal tap-in sealing all three points for Ancelotti’s side in another classic comeback in the Spanish capital.

When will Hernández Hernández referee his next game?

Hernández Hernández is in charge of the VAR in the Copa del Rey match between Atlético de Madrid and Sevilla to be played this Thursday. However, Carreño has stated that this opinion of the CTA will not lead to the replacement of the referee.

The information was made known the same day in which the Technical Committee of Referees have filed an official police report regarding the leak of audios of the match, and the Spanish Football Federation (RFEF) have done the same with Almería’s Gonzalo Melero, who accused the referees of stealing.
